Meaghan is a Tennessee native, born and raised on Signal Mountain. She received her dual degree Bachelor of Architecture and Interior Architecture from Auburn University's College of Architecture Design and Construction.

Upon graduation, Meaghan planted her roots in Nashville. She joined HASTINGS in 2010. Meaghan takes pride in managing projects of varying scales from initial design stages through construction. Her contributions to HASTINGS include Wallace and Lowry Hall at Montgomery Bell Academy, Pinnacle Financial Partners, and Vanderbilt University’s Nicholas S. Zeppos College, Rothschild College, and Residential College C.

Through these impactful collaborations, she dedicates herself to serving her clients, cultivating teamwork, and is passionate about continuously learning. Always eager to serve her community and the next generation of architects, Meaghan has been actively involved with the AIA of Middle Tennessee and has served on the Board of Directors and led the Emerging Professionals program.
